API between Piwigo and Wikimedia Commons?

I am wondering what the possibility is of getting an API that is able to transfer content from Piwigo to Wikimedia Commons.  I occasionally upload Creative Commons-licensed content to my photo site, and I then turn around and also upload it to Wikimedia Commons in order for those works to be available to that community.  Currently, I have to complete the upload process twice: once for Piwigo and once for Wikimedia Commons.  It would be great if I could just port it directly over from one to the other.
